He joined in the 1971 Attica uprising earned a college degree in 1977 and was rejected 18 times at parole hearings, the last time in 2015.Ī half-century after the slow killing of Ms. While at Attica Correctional Facility, in 1968, he escaped while on a hospital visit to Buffalo, raped a woman and held hostages at gunpoint before being recaptured. Moseley was condemned to die in the electric chair, but in 1967, two years after New York State abolished most capital punishments, he won an appeal that reduced his sentence to an indeterminate life term. His life behind bars had been relatively eventful.

He had been imprisoned for almost 52 years, since July 7, 1964, and was one of the state’s longest-serving inmates.

Moseley, a psychopathic serial killer and necrophiliac, died at the maximum security Clinton Correctional Facility in Dannemora, N.Y., near the Canadian border. A medical examiner would determine the cause of death, Mr. Bailey, a spokesman for the New York State Department of Corrections and Community Supervision, confirmed the death on Monday. Winston Moseley, who stalked, raped and killed Kitty Genovese in a prolonged knife attack in New York in 1964 while neighbors failed to act on her desperate cries for help - a nightmarish tableau that came to symbolize urban apathy in America - died on March 28, in prison.
